Ruth Rogers was born on October 4, 1918 in Tracy, California, USA. She was an actress, known for Hidden Gold (1940), Silver on the Sage (1939) and The Night Riders (1939). She died on October 9, 1953. She entered a beauty contest in Spokane, Washington hoping to win a screen test, but lost. She returned to her job as a cashier where she was discovered by a talent scout.
